Latest Patents
One of her latest patents is the "Intraoperative Alignment Assessment System and Method." This invention provides systems, assemblies, and methods for analyzing patient anatomy, specifically focusing on the spine. The system includes obtaining initial patient data, acquiring spinal alignment and contour information, and assessing localized anatomical features. It also analyzes the biomechanical effects of implants and outputs localized anatomical analyses and therapeutic device contouring data on a display.
